What Does 0% Intro APR Actually Imply?
When a card presents 0% intro APR, it means your enterprise gained’t pay curiosity on new purchases (and typically stability transfers) for a selected interval—usually 6 to 18 months. This isn’t a everlasting characteristic. As soon as the promotional interval ends, the speed jumps to the usual APR, which often ranges from 14% to 29% relying in your creditworthiness and the cardboard issuer.
Consider it as a short lived monetary cushion that provides you respiratory room to repay purchases earlier than curiosity kicks in.

Dangers and Issues to Watch Out For
Whereas 0% intro APR presents sound good, they arrive with high quality print that may affect your funds if ignored. Listed here are the primary pitfalls:
Intro interval expiration: As soon as the promotional window closes, curiosity applies to any remaining stability on the full APR price.
Minimal funds nonetheless required: Even throughout 0% APR, you should make minimal month-to-month funds or face late charges and potential lack of the promotional price.
Steadiness switch charges: For those who’re utilizing the cardboard to consolidate debt, count on charges of three% to five% of the switch quantity.
Overspending temptation: The shortage of curiosity can encourage pointless purchases that pressure your price range later.
Deal with the cardboard as a enterprise instrument, not a monetary security internet.
Find out how to Select the Proper Card
Choosing the right 0% intro enterprise bank card depends upon your monetary objectives and reimbursement capacity. Begin by evaluating the size of promotional intervals—some lengthen as much as 18 months, providing you with extra time to repay purchases interest-free.
Subsequent, study the usual APR that kicks in after the promo interval. This price can considerably affect your prices if you happen to don’t clear the stability in time. Take into account whether or not the cardboard prices an annual charge and if the advantages—like cashback, enterprise instruments, or journey rewards—justify the price.
Search for business-friendly options like worker playing cards, expense monitoring, and integration with accounting software program to simplify monetary administration.

FAQ’s
Can I exploit a 0% intro APR enterprise card for private bills?
Technically sure, nevertheless it’s not really helpful. Mixing private and enterprise bills complicates tax reporting and may harm your enterprise credit score profile.
What occurs if I miss a cost in the course of the promo interval?
Lacking funds could cancel the 0% supply instantly, and you can face curiosity prices plus late charges on the complete stability.
Can I get accredited with truthful or common credit score?
Some issuers supply playing cards to candidates with common credit score, however you might not qualify for the perfect phrases or longest intro APR intervals.
